Best of Besties in LGBTQ+ Cinema (Virtual Panel)

Thu, Apr 11, 2024
VIRTUAL ONLY
    Part of
  • BAM Film 2024
  • and
  • Queering the Canon: Besties

For this year’s Queering the Canon, NewFest and BAM are celebrating the queer bestie. Your ride or die, your best Judy, the one who got you through every heartbreak and hangover. While everyone loves a steamy romance, it’s those joyful stories of queer friendship and community that show us as we truly are. 

We all need a bosom buddy in our corner, but who has written those stories and who is writing them today? How have queer films of the past portrayed bestie dynamics? What do we dream of within our bestie stories, and what hidden gems from the past can be re-evaluated to celebrate the queer bestie as its own narrative? 

This panel discussion addresses these questions, and more, with a group of genuinely funny and thoughtful cinephiles, experts, and besties. Moderated by critic and filmmaker Jude Dry, panelists include filmmaker Angela Robinson (D.E.B.S, The L Word, Professor Marston and the Wonder Women); comedian, actor, and screenwriter Joel Kim Booster (Fire Island); and filmmaker, curator, and historian Jenni Olson.
